The most recent transfer news for Birmingham City brings positive developments, as a Championship competitor, Hull City, has clarified that they are not pursuing a reported target shared with Birmingham. Last week, both Birmingham City and Hull City were linked with Barnsley defender Callum Styles. EFL journalist Alan Nixon, in a post on his Patreon page, mentioned Styles being on Birmingham’s ‘radar,’ but Hull Live’s correspondent Baz Cooper has now debunked this claim. Responding to questions about a potential move, Cooper stated, “Not a player #HCAFC are in for, no.”

Although Hull was initially considered the frontrunner according to Nixon’s report, the current status of Styles’ situation remains uncertain. Birmingham City presently relies on Lee Buchanan as their primary left-back, with Emmanuel Longelo stepping in when Buchanan is unavailable.

In a significant move, Birmingham City secured their first signing under Tony Mowbray’s management last week, welcoming Andre Dozzell to the team. Dozzell, who debuted in the 2-1 victory against Stoke City, signed on Friday and played 19 minutes off the bench. According to QPR boss Martí Cifuentes, Dozzell’s move was instigated by the player’s own push for the transfer. Cifuentes praised Dozzell’s attitude and contributions during his time at Loftus Road. With Dozzell’s contract expiring in the summer, a permanent move to St Andrew’s could be on the cards if he impresses. Cifuentes expressed gratitude for Dozzell’s efforts, acknowledging that players don’t make such moves without a desire for change and wished him well, emphasizing Dozzell’s exceptional behavior during their time together.
